What are the key skills and qualifications needed to thrive as a Freelance RF Drive Test Engineer, and why are they important?

To thrive as a Freelance RF Drive Test Engineer, you need a solid understanding of wireless communication principles, RF measurement techniques, and a relevant degree in telecommunications or electrical engineering. Familiarity with drive test tools such as TEMS, Nemo, or Agilent, as well as proficiency in data analysis software, is typically required. Strong problem-solving skills, attention to detail, and the ability to communicate findings clearly are important soft skills for this role. These skills ensure accurate network performance assessment, effective troubleshooting, and clear reporting, all of which are critical for optimizing wireless networks.

What are Freelance RF Drive Test Engineers?

Freelance RF Drive Test Engineers are independent professionals who specialize in testing and optimizing the performance of wireless networks. They use specialized equipment to collect data on signal strength, coverage, and quality by driving through designated routes or walking in specific areas. Their findings help telecom companies identify network issues, improve coverage, and enhance user experience. Working as freelancers, they take on projects from various clients and may operate in different locations as needed.

What are some common challenges faced by freelance RF Drive Test Engineers and how can they be addressed?

Freelance RF Drive Test Engineers often encounter challenges such as managing variable project schedules, adapting to different client requirements, and maintaining up-to-date knowledge of testing tools and technologies. To address these, it's important to develop strong organizational skills, stay proactive in communication with clients, and regularly invest time in learning about the latest RF equipment and software. Flexibility and a willingness to travel are also crucial, as projects may require work in diverse geographic locations or environments. Building a reliable network with other engineers and industry professionals can help secure steady work and provide support when facing technical or logistical issues.
